Horizontal Jumps
Long Jump
The most accessible of the horizontal jumps, combining a sprint approach with a powerful takeoff and a controlled landing. Technical development focuses on approach run consistency, takeoff mechanics and flight position.
Horizontal Jumps
Triple Jump
One of athletics’ most technically demanding events — a hop, step and jump sequence requiring coordination, strength and precise timing. Athletes typically develop long jump foundations before progressing to triple jump.
Vertical Jumps
High Jump
Combining speed, flexibility and explosive power, high jump rewards technical precision as much as physical ability.
The Fosbury Flop technique is the focus for competitive athletes at all levels.

where we train
Training at Edmondscote Athletics Track
All jumps training takes place at Edmondscote Athletics Track, River Close, Leamington Spa, CV32 6AD.
Edmondscote has dedicated long jump and triple jump runways with sand pits, and a high jump area — providing everything needed for training and competition preparation in a well-maintained facility.
